Eric and Jorja’s PSA is part of the 30 Days for a Million Voices campaign. The US Campaign for Burma unveils a spot every day(usually they are a bit early) and encourages people to sign up and support the Burmese people. Here’s bit about struggle.

The people of the Southeast Asian country of Burma are locked in one of the world’s great freedom struggles. The country’s military rulers, the State Peace and Development Council, have run the country with an iron fist for the past 19 years, after they assumed power from a 26-year socialist dictatorship. In 1988, students, professionals, and others launched a nationwide uprising aimed at bringing an end to authoritarian rule during which millions of people courageously marched on the streets, calling for freedom and democracy.

The military responded by gunning down thousands of demonstrators and imprisoning thousands more in one of Southeast Asia’s most bloody episodes in recent history. The leader of the demonstrations, Min Ko Naing (pronounced Min Ko Nine), has been held behind bars ever since, where approximately 1,400 political prisoners remain. The most recognizable face of Burma, 1991 Nobel Peace Prize recipient Daw Aung San Suu Kyi (pronounced Daw Aung Sawn Sue Chee), has been in and out of house arrest and prison since 1988. Presently, she is held under house arrest.

Those Close to Gary Dourdan Express Concern

Thursday, May 1st, 2008

 

hsdourdan.jpg

According to the Chicago Sun-Times, those close to Gary Dourdan have been concerned before the latest incident. ”We have been worried about Gary for some time,” a member the show’s production team told the the newspaper. ”It’s just a shame that he wasn’t able to get the help he needs before this happened.”

robhall.jpg

Actor Robert David Hall spoke with Newsday.com  on Wednesday about the troubled actor’s arrest.

“I actually worked with him yesterday, and everybody was moving on. It’s real hard to get work done when your’re so close to the end of the season .”

He also talked about the support Gary has from the cast and crew. “Almost to a person, I’d say ninety-nine percent of the cast and crew are very hopeful that Gary will be OK, and we love him deeply.”

When questioned about Gary’s departure, Hall didn’t have a concrete answer.  “He wants to do other things,” Hall said. “That’s the speculation…You and I and the majority of other people would say, why would anyone leave a hit show  but everybody’s different. I can’t comment on why Gary and CBS are parting company, but I was told he has dreams of doing other things. He’s a generous, soulful guy. I read the same stuff you do. I just know him as the guy who gave me a big hug yesterday. The cast and crew want the best for Gary.”

There’s still no official statement from Gary’s camp.  He’s due to be arraigned on May 28th. Let’s keep Gary in our thoughts.

Palm Springs PD Issues Official Statement About Gary Dourdan’s Drug Charges

Wednesday, April 30th, 2008

normal_csi-lv-803_05.jpg

Palm Springs Police Department issued this statement regarding Gary’s arrest. There isn’t any new information from what I can tell.

On Monday, April 28 at approximately 5:12 AM, a Palm Springs patrol officer saw an occupied vehicle parked on the wrong side of the street on Sunny Dunes Road west of Gene Autry Trail. According to police reports, the interior light was on and it appeared as if the occupant of the vehicle in the driver’s seat was sleeping. The officer approached the vehicle and made contact with the occupant. He was identified by his California driver’s license as 41-year-old Robert Gary Durdin [Dourdan’s legal name] of Venice, CA. The officer described Durdin as disoriented and possibly under the influence of alcohol and/or drugs. The officer subsequently located suspected cocaine, heroin, ecstacy, miscellaneous prescription drugs, and paraphernalia. Durdin was placed under arrest and booked at the Palm Springs Jail for Possession of Narcotics and Possession of Dangerous Drugs. After booking, he was released on $5,000 bail at approximately 10:30 AM on Monday.

Gary Dourdan Leaving CSI

Monday, April 14th, 2008

normal_csi-lv-803_05.jpg

After 8 seasons it’s miracle that his much of the cast is still on board. With Jorja leaving in the fall I expected at least one cast member to follow sooner rather than later. According to TV Guide’s Ausiello, the next original cast member to leave is Gary Dourdan.

Sources confirm to me exclusively that original CSIer Gary Dourdan — whose contract is also set to expire next month — has informed producers that he is leaving the show. Although a precise timeframe is not known, CSI’s May 15 season finale could serve as Warrick’s swan song.

A spokesman for CBS would neither confirm or deny the story. I translate that to mean, “He’s quite but we are trying to convince him to stay.”

Eight years is looong time to do a serial. Filming something as complicated as CSI is like filming a mini movie every week. I can imagine it takes a toll on your life.

Supposedly CSI is already looking for a new cast member to play the part of   Ray Santoro “who transfers from Henderson to join the graveyard shift at the Las Vegas crime lab.”
